Abstract

A method, system and computer program product for downloading an application over a network from a remote server to a client device, where the application includes a plurality of modules. A class for each module is created, where the class includes a constructor. A request to use a module of the application is received. Upon receiving the request, a determination is made as to whether the received request is a first request to use the module. If the received request is the first request to use the module, then the requested module is downloaded, the constructor is overwritten with the downloaded module and the constructor within the created class for the requested module is executed.

Claims (32)

1. A method for downloading an application over a network from a remote server to a client device, the application comprising a plurality of modules, the method comprising:

creating a class for each module of the plurality of modules, the class comprising a stub constructor;

receiving a request to use a module of the plurality of modules of the application;

determining if the received request is a first request to use the module;

downloading the requested module in response to the received request being the first request to use the module;

overwriting the stub constructor with the downloaded module having a module constructor in response to the received request being the first request to use the module; and

executing, by a processor, the module constructor within the created class for the requested module.

2. The method as recited in claim 1 , wherein the creating of the class for the module comprises creating a new class under the module's path name.

3. The method as recited in claim 1 , wherein the created class for each module is empty apart from the stub constructor.

4. The method as recited in claim 1 , wherein the overwriting of the stub constructor with the downloaded module results in a creation of a class containing the downloaded module.
